List of names as written Various modes of spelling Authorities for spelling Situation Description remarks
LOCH TETH Loch Teth Roderick Campbell Strath Gairloch 044 A wide portion on Abhuinn Achadh a' Chairn on the north Side of the County road lading from Gairloch to Poolewe and north east of Clach na Bròig Sig. [Signification] "Warm Loch".
ACHADH AN FHRAOICH Achadh an Fhraoich Roderick Campbell Strath Gairloch 044 A piece of Rough Heathy pasture surrounded by an old Stone wall between Meall Ruigh a' Ghobhainn and the public road leading from Gairloch to Poolewe. Sig: [Signification] "Plain of the Heather".
LOCHAN NAM BREAC Lochan nam Breac Roderick Campbell Strath Gairloch 044 A large loch Situated between Achadh Lochan nam Breac and Creagan Doire na Suaine Sig: [Signification] "Loch of the Trouts"
ACHADH LOCHAN NAM BREAC Achadh Lochan nam Breac Roderick Campbell Strath Gairloch 044 A portion of rough heathy pasture enclosed within old stone walls between Lochan nam Breac and Sithean Donn Sig: [Signification] "Field of the little Loch of the trouts".
